Suits Season 7 Episode 12 'Bad Man'
A stressful week for everyone at the Specter-Litt firm, with everything happening at once with Harvey facing ending his father's musical legacy, Louis seeing his love of his life come back but not like it seems, and Mike getting spit in his face from who he thought was his friend.

Jessica's Money...
Jessica wants $2 Million from her payout in an untraceable account, telling Harvey to get it done with no reason and that he needs to believe in her that it isn't to do anything illegal, and her being like family to Harvey, he accepts, but it isn't that easy. In order for it to work, Harvey has to convince his father's producer to sell his company and his records, but that means Harvey's father's music may never be played again. Vic owing Harvey money, gets convinced to sell the company, even though it is incredibly hard for both of them, but to Harvey it's the only way for him to get Jessica her money.

Bad Boy...
Louis as he is having a mud bath like usual, Sheila comes in and trues to seduce him and ending with her leaving him a burner phone to contact her for times to continue their affair behind her fiance's back. Louis is and always have been into things he could never have, always been into women that are already taken because of what happened in that past with his girlfriend in high school. His visit with his therapist, Dr. Lipschitz, makes him realise that in order for him to get the girl, he has to be a bad boy, and Dr. Lipschitz says "We both know you are not a bad boy." Later leaving Louis with a big dilemma of whether trying to get Sheila back through traditional means, or be a bad boy and win her over through the affair.

Enough is Enough...
Harvey not being able to wait, and having no one to lean on with everything that has been happening in his life and the firm, he goes straight to Paula's office. He admits to Paula that Donna is special and that she's more than just some woman he works with, but at the end of the day, Paula is the one, the one that helped him mend ties with his mother, and when he wanted to rely on someone about his father's legacy ending, the only one he thought of was Paula. And thus, Harvey charms his way back into Paula's good graces.
Thought Oliver was his Friend...
Oliver is representing a food bank in which he's in renegotiation after one of their suppliers, a Specter-Litt client, increased the price of their protein packs and being a friend of Mike's, hopes he'll be able to fix it in favour to Oliver. Mike was able to cut a good deal for his friend Oliver, or so he thought, but Oliver doesn't like the price and quickly announces that he's going to depose the supplier's CEO, pissing Mike the hell off.

Mike Comes Back...
Oliver wipes the floor with Mike in the deposition and Mike thought that Oliver just wanted to hear that he wiped the floor with him, but it isn't. Mike is later able to get an even better deal than before, but Oliver won't accept it, so it starts to become personal. Mike realises that he has to put an end to his, and for Oliver's sake teach him a lesson, but the problem being, Mike doesn't think he has it in him to do such a thing, but Rachel points out that if Mike doesn't do this, in the long run it'll ruin Oliver. With the help of Rachel, Mike is able to find compelling evidence to throw the hammer down on Oliver and it was brutal, but in the end, Oliver gets the message and also is very thankful for it.

Change it up, a Different Louis...
Louis with his huge dilemma the whole time with everything happening with Donna, Harvey, Mike, keeps thinking of what would of happened back in high school with his girlfriend cheating on him because he wasn't a bad boy. He then changes his ways, and chooses to become a bad boy, showing up at Sheila's office, ready to be that guy!
